A contractor accidentally burned down a house, but it's not as bad as it sounds.
Investigators with Mobile Fire-Rescue say the home on Congress Street and Lexington Avenue was being demolished. The unexpected fire just finished the job.
The contractor was burning scraps of wood in a fire pit. The flames got out of control and burned what was left of the home.
He was fined $200 for illegal burning.
